In recent years, the web development industry in Thailand has seen its fair share of tragedies, with several companies failing to stay afloat in an increasingly competitive market. While some of these companies have struggled due to factors beyond their control, others have succumbed to avoidable mistakes that serve as valuable lessons for aspiring entrepreneurs and established businesses alike. One of the key reasons behind the downfall of web development companies in Thailand has been a lack of adaptability and innovation. In a fast-paced industry where new technologies and trends emerge regularly, companies that fail to keep up risk becoming obsolete. Those who rest on their laurels and refuse to embrace change often find themselves outpaced by more agile competitors. Another common pitfall has been a failure to prioritize customer satisfaction. Building strong relationships with clients is essential in the service industry, and companies that neglect this aspect of their business risk losing valuable customers to competitors. Delivering high-quality work on time and providing excellent customer service are crucial for long-term success in the web development industry. Furthermore, many web development companies in Thailand have struggled with poor financial management practices. Running a business requires careful budgeting, monitoring cash flow, and making strategic investments. Companies that fail to manage their finances effectively can quickly find themselves in dire straits, unable to meet their financial obligations and sustain their operations. Lastly, a lack of a clear market positioning and differentiation strategy has also been a downfall for some web development companies in Thailand. In a crowded marketplace, companies need to carve out a unique selling proposition that resonates with their target audience. Without a clear value proposition and a strong branding strategy, companies risk blending into the background and struggling to attract new customers. In conclusion, the tragic fall of web development companies in Thailand serves as a sobering reminder of the challenges and pitfalls that businesses of all sizes and industries must navigate. By prioritizing adaptability, customer satisfaction, financial management, and differentiation strategies, companies can increase their chances of long-term success and avoid the fate that has befallen many in the industry.
